XYLOSE ISOMERASE FROM BACILLUS STEAROTHERMOPHILUSXYLOSE ISOMERASE FROM BACILLUS STEAROTHERMOPHILUS

Structural highlights

1a0d is a 4 chain structure with sequence from Geobacillus stearothermophilus. Full crystallographic information is available from OCA. For a guided tour on the structure components use FirstGlance.
Method:X-ray diffraction, Resolution 3Å
